After a long winter, a good spring cleaning is a great way to bring a sense of renewal to your home. This year, try green cleaning your home. Families across the country are adopting new ways to clean that are good for the environment and healthy for their families. The main goal of green cleaning is to use cleaning solutions and methods that will keep our environment healthy. Try using non-toxic cleaning products. Look for green cleaners that are "biodegradable", "phosphate-free", or "petroleum-free". Choose cleaners that do not contain ammonia or chlorine because they give off toxic fumes that can irritate eyes and respiratory systems. Try making your own cleaners at home. Even the biggest messes and toughest stains can be tackled with baking soda, borax, lemon juice and more.
